## Deployment: Hot-Reloading Config

Quick heads-up for the security folks: Larkspool watches its config file and hot-reloads on change, no restart needed. Yes, that means a bad edit can land live in seconds — we mitigate with schema validation before swap, and rejected configs keep the old values in memory. Reload events are logged with a diff, so audit trails stay intact. Nothing secret lives in this file; credentials come from the vault sidecar. Here's what the service currently runs with.

config for bawig-fadup:
[zorix]
host = zorix.lumicworks.corp
user = zorix_svc
database = zorix_prod

## Environments: Brightkit Component Library

Welcome aboard. Brightkit is versioned independently of the apps that consume it, so each environment in the Marling pipeline can pin a different release. Staging tracks the latest minor; production pins an exact patch and only moves after the Aldercrest design review signs off. As a contractor, never bump the pin yourself — file a request instead. Each environment's current pins and resolution settings are recorded below.

deployment values, yadug-bawif:
[framir]
team = pelox
access_code = ac_a38ab2
owner = tamion.julael
host = framir.tolvaqlabs.test
port = 11211
peer = tammir.zemvargrid.local
salt = 2215ef03
pin = 1541

Onboarding note for the Ledgerpane admin table: bulk edits are applied through the batcher service, not directly against the database. Select rows, choose an action, and the batcher stages changes in a pending set you can review before commit. Edits over 500 rows require a second approver — this is enforced server-side, so don't try to chunk around it. To run the batcher locally you need the staging write credential, which goes in your .env as the next line.

secret setting of bahip-kagag: RELAY_SECRET3=c83